We have extensive trial and appellate experience on issues related to child custody, tracing and classification of assets and income, division of property and child support and maintenance (formerly known as alimony).Some recent noteworthy successes include: The classification of Husband's stock in a closely held corporation as marital property. Prior to the marriage Husband held 2305 fully vested and exercisable stock options at a strike price of $1.00 per share. The options were not exercised until two years after the marriage and the strike price paid with marital funds. At the time of trial the stock was valued in excess of $6,000,000. The Wife, our client, was awarded $2,500,000 for her interest in the stock, from an investment of $2,305 of marital funds. We successfully defended the Judgment on appeal in the Second District Appellate Court and on a Petition for Leave to Appeal to the Illinois Supreme Court. The reversal of an award of exclusive possession of the marital residence to Wife. On Appeal in the First District Appellate Court, the trial court was found to have erred in ordering the Husband to vacate the marital residence due to the claim that his presence caused the Wife stress and discomfort. This was the first published case on the issue of exclusive possession in 17 years.
